I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Robert Junior
Vanmeter
October 31, 1924 – November 17, 2014
Robert Junior VanMeter, 90, of Silver Lake, Indiana passed away at 8:20 p.m. on Monday, November 17, 2014 at Wabash County Hospital in Wabash, Indiana. He was born to the late Fred and Helen (Shatto) VanMeter on October 31, 1924 in Jackson Township, Indiana.
Robert served his country in the United States Army Air Force during WWII, he was a gunner on the B Twenty Fives. He married Pat Smith in 1992, she survives. He was an agent for Allstate in Wabash, Indiana for 37 years, he retired after working for George Scheer for 2 years. He was a member of Faith Baptist Church in Wabash, Indiana.
He is also survived by his sons, Robert VanMeter (Debbie) of Troy, Ohio, Daniel VanMeter of Billings, Montana, Michael VanMeter of Kansas, Tony VanMeter (Karen) of Englewood, Texas; step sons, Alan Weitzel (Monica) of Akron, Indiana, Tim Weitzel of Toledo, Ohio, Eric Weitzel (Patty) of Silver Lake, Indiana, Patrick Weitzel (Kelly) of Andrews, Indiana; daughters, Mrs. William (Vickie) Tackett of Ocala, Florida and Mrs. Bruce (Dana) Harp of Logansport, Indiana; step daughter, Diane Weitzel of Peru, Indiana; brother, Richard VanMeter of Huntington, Indiana; sisters, Betty Wolfe of Fort Wayne, Indiana and Mrs. Rex (Sandy) Baxter of Huntington, Indiana; 20 Grandchildren and several great grandchildren. He was preceded in death by a son, Ronnie, 5 brothers and 4 sisters.
